Original Tender Description

Fermanagh and Omagh District Council (FODC) invite application from suitably Qualified Service Providers to participate in a Pre Qualification Exercise for the appointment of an Economic Operator to provide the services of an Integrated Consultancy Team (ICT) to prepare, develop and project manage the delivery of the scheme for the Greenhill Crematorium, Omagh project including all aspects of the RIBA 2020 plan of work from Stages 0-7, working alongside FODC staff to prepare all design and legislative requirements and project management for the delivery of the project.
